Output ef3cc0762206cdc282f01ff42f481081bf659a628964888839d2ec6596098ea0:0

value
4357488
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 74363baddc799f6ea5e2e34ba7118071ff0df7fd OP_EQUALVERIFY OP_CHECKSIG
address
1BbUMSGdsXfeUEZoLTTmP8rpoJrsiwfbYw
transaction
ef3cc0762206cdc282f01ff42f481081bf659a628964888839d2ec6596098ea0
spent
true